An Introduction to Valerian Root

Valerian root is a herbal remedy that has been used for centuries to alleviate a variety of health issues. This natural supplement is derived from the root of the valerian plant, which is primarily found in Europe and Asia. Valerian root supplements are available in various forms such as capsules, extracts, and teas.

Benefits of Valerian Root

Valerian root is widely known for its calming and sedative properties. It is an effective remedy for reducing anxiety, promoting relaxation, and improving the quality of sleep. Additionally, valerian root may be beneficial in reducing menstrual cramps and digestive issues.

How Valerian Root Works

Valerian root contains compounds that interact with the neurotransmitters in our brain, such as gamma-aminobutyric acid (GABA). GABA helps to reduce stress and anxiety by blocking certain brain signals. Additionally, valerian root contains alkaloids and volatile oils that contribute to its sedative effects.

Valerian Root Dosage

The recommended dosage of valerian root varies depending on the intended use. For anxiety and stress relief, a dosage of 300-900mg per day is typically recommended. For improving the quality of sleep, a dosage of 400-900mg per day may be effective. However, it is important to note that high doses may cause adverse effects. Therefore, it is imperative to consult a healthcare provider before consuming valerian root supplements.

Potential Side Effects of Valerian Root

Valerian root is generally safe for most people, but some may experience side effects such as dizziness, headaches, and upset stomach. It should also be avoided by pregnant or breastfeeding women and those with liver disease. Additionally, valerian root may interact with certain medications such as sedatives, antidepressants, and antihistamines.

Valerian Root Tea

Valerian root tea is a popular way to consume this natural supplement. Simply steep 1-2 teaspoons of dried valerian root in hot water for 5-10 minutes. It can be enjoyed hot or iced. However, it is important to note that valerian root tea may have a strong and unpleasant smell and taste.

Valerian Root and Melatonin

Valerian root and melatonin are often used together to promote relaxation and improve sleep quality. Melatonin is a hormone that helps regulate sleep, while valerian root can help calm the mind and body. However, it is imperative to consult a healthcare provider before combining these supplements.

Valerian Root and Kava

Valerian root and kava are both natural supplements that are commonly used for anxiety relief. While valerian root is primarily known for its calming properties, kava has been shown to reduce anxiety and promote a sense of well-being. However, kava should be consumed with caution as it may cause liver damage.
